Output 3e0736792cfca9b8a71867f6b2f26fb87d3f18fb00a0a7854c3ac27c0bc0abda: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375c964d0037786d613d497d41bf2fc53e646 OP_EQUAL
address
3BMEXbCrnezpE6byz2AdhQfPdCEgdQyMSe
transaction
3e0736792cfca9b8a71867f6b2f26fb87d3f18fb00a0a7854c3ac27c0bc0abda
confirmations
348683
spent
true